BoN update: Recession in 2017
Overall economic growth last year was likely negative, the Bank of Namibia (BoN) says in its latest Economic Outlook Update.
The BoN expects growth of -0.6% for 2017. In December, the BoN still forecast growth of 0.6%. In the beginning of last year, the central bank hoped for 2.9%.
According to the website of the Namibia Statistics Agency (NSA), official gross domestic product (GDP) figures for 2017 will be released on 29 March.
